Dewatering solution for spent grain

Managing wet distillers or brewers grain immediately after brewing is crucial to prevent rotting and increase resale value. This process requires reducing moisture levels to around 60%, making the grain viable for multiple uses including animal feeds and fertilizers.

Reduce moisture in grain efficiently

The Bonnot Company’s Dewatering Extruders utilize a continuous mechanical screw press to lower the moisture content of spent grain. This efficient process brings moisture levels down to approximately 60%, making the grain dry to the touch. In addition to extending shelf life, this reduction also significantly cuts transportation costs, as the weight of the grain is lowered. The extruders are designed to be simple, robust, and cost-effective, featuring replaceable stainless steel screens, as well as shrouding and water collection devices to manage the extracted water. The model DW 8 Series, with a 10 HP motor and dimensions of 110″ x 24″ x 62.5″, processes up to 2000 lbs/hour, making it suitable for high-volume operations.
